The Widefiled High School Forensics team would like to invite you and your team to the Widefield High School Invitational Tournament on Saturday, January 16, 2020

 

We will be offering three rounds and finals in Drama, Humor, Poetry, Duo, POI, National Extemporaneous Speaking, International Extemporaneous Speaking, Original Oratory, Informative Speaking, LD Debate, and Public Forum Debate. 

 

  • Synchronous Live Events: National Extemporaneous Speaking, International Extemporaneous Speaking, Lincoln-Douglas Debate, and Public Forum Debate

 

  • Asynchronous Recorded Events: Drama, Humor, Poetry, Program Oral Interpretation, Original Oratory, Informative Speaking, and Duo (Split screen format)

    • For asynchronous recorded events, each competitor must record their performance. Recordings must be submitted by providing a URL link to the recording in Speechwire by Wednesday, January 13 at 3pm. The URL must be a link that can be opened by anyone who clicks on the link.


 

Doubling:

  • Students may double-enter by entering 1 synchronous event and 1 asynchronous event OR by entering 2 asynchronous events, OR by entering 2 synchronous events (1 in each wave)

  • Students in synchronous events cannot double-enter in events in the same Wave.

  • Wave A = the extemps, Wave B = the debates

Debate Topics:

LD (Jan/Feb topic): Resolved: States ought to ban lethal autonomous weapons.

 

PF (Jan topic): Resolved: The National Security Agency should end its surveillance of U.S. citizens and lawful permanent residents.
